[Effect of daphnetin on SOD activity and DNA synthesis of Plasmodium falciparum in vitro].

Ling-yun Mu1, Qin-mei Wang, Yi-chang Ni.   

Abstract

OBJECTIVE: To investigate the effect of daphnetin on superoxide dismutase (SOD) activity and DNA synthesis in P. falciparum in vitro.
METHODS: The effect of daphnetin, daphnetin-Fe complex and desferrioxamine B on SOD activity of P. falciparum (P.f) FCC1 in vitro was determined with a SOD test-kit. The level of DNA synthesis of P.f synchronized cultured in vitro at various developmental stages after treatment of daphnetin or desferrioxamine B was assayed by fluorescein Hoechest 33258.
RESULTS: The total SOD activity decreased by 60% after daphnetin treatment while it only decreased by 22% if treated with desferrioxamine B. No effect on SOD activity of P.f treated with daphnetin-Fe complex was observed. The level of DNA synthesis of P.f trophozoites in synchronized in vitro culture was significantly lower than that of the control.
CONCLUSION: Daphnetin lowered SOD activity and decreased DNA synthesis of P.f in vitro.
